AEi Systems is a United States space and power electronics engineering firm headquartered in Henderson, Nevada with engineers in several cities, including a significant engineering center in Los Angeles, California.

AEi Systems is most well known for its analysis of space-bound and other industrial power supplies and power systems—especially those that must operate reliably under extreme conditions (such as radiation, magnetic fields, heat, and the like) and yet also keep within size and weight limitations.[1][2]

AEi Systems is the world leader in Worst Case Circuit Analysis (WCCA) and failure and reliability analysis for space-bound DC-DC converters.

History

The company's predecessor, Analytical Engineering, Inc., was founded in 1995. The company met with significant early success as the developer of simulation models and performed worst case circuit analysis on International Space Station's power buss electronics. A series of satellite projects continued to keep founder Steve Sandler and Analytical Engineering busy, including Tempo, Globalstar, Goes, GPS, MCI Omegasat and P-81. Analytical Engineering provided computer simulation models and worst case circuit analysis on most projects.

In 2002, with the idea of expanding the business and the management team, the businesses of Analytical Engineering, Inc. in Arizona, and a related company, Analytical Services, Inc. in New York, were combined and purchased by AEi Systems, LLC and moved to Los Angeles in transactions spearheaded by Charles Hymowitz (an electrical engineer formerly of McDonnell Douglas and Intusoft) and his business partner, Lee Weinberg.

Since 2002, AEi Systems has continued its growth in Worst Case Circuit Analysis (WCCA) and failure and reliability analysis for space-bound DC-DC converters. In addition, the company has expanded its digital analysis capabilities, including signal integrity.

Divisions/Organization

The company has four, inter-related business lines:

  • Analysis : Worst Case Circuit Analysis (WCCA) and failure and reliability analyses; signal integrity and other digital analyses.
  • SPICE Modeling : Modeling of complex integrated circuits for major manufacturers and to support AEi Systems analysis and design work.
  • Software : Sale of licensed copies of (i) the company's Power IC Model Library for PSpice, and (ii) WCCA templates and tables.

Noteworthy achievements and facts

  • Motorola University's "six sigma class" on worst case analysis was created by AEi Systems
  • AEi Systems performed important work on the LVPS power supply for the Atlas Experiment at the Large Hadron Collider (LHC) at CERN (the world's largest and most powerful particle accelerator that revealed the Higgs Boson).
  • AEi Systems has worked on analyses of several critical components of the GPS III program.[3]
  • Most SPICE models for Power ICs that electrical engineers find on the Internet were created by AEi Systems, including those found on the websites of ON Semiconductor and Texas Instruments and used via National Semiconductor's (now Texas Instruments) online WEBENCH tool
  • AEi Systems analyzed the power buss for the International Space Station

SPICE Modeling

AEi Systems provides SPICE models to many major IC manufacturers, including Texas Instruments, ON Semiconductor and National Semiconductor.

Since 2005, this business unit has produced and distributed the Power IC Model Library for PSpice,[4][5] which is distributed by Cadence's sole North American distributor (EMA-EDA) in the United States and Canada, and by other major distributors in Asia and Europe.

WCCA Training and Support

The company developed and taught the "six sigma" WCCA training class for Motorola University, and continues to teach WCCA techniques via on-site classes for customers as well as several LA-based workshops.
